Anya is a girl who is posing as a male and serves guard duty at a military post designed by humans. She belongs to a genetically engineered species of the "Dogs." Their planet used to be Earth's penal colony, but humanity was destroyed long ago on the mother planet. In this place, surviving humans live like gods and all the work is done by Dogs. Together with her brother and his friend, she becomes part of a terrorist cell. They are connected to the peasant outlaws who dream of the extinction of the surviving humans. The Day of Truth is coming.
Zoran Maslic is an award-winning underground filmmaker from Canada known for his feature length documentary trilogy In the City of Exile Kings (When You Die as a Cat, Nobody Knows My Songs, and Annoying.) His film When You Die as a Cat received a Golden Pre-Colombian Circle prize for the best social documentary at the 2010 Bogota Film Festival and was honoured at the Festival Temps d'Images in Lisbon (2009.) He also directs music videos (Zoran Maslic, YouTube.) In 2014, he produced and released a folk punk album called Duct Tape Rose by Chad Fontaine. This is Maslic's first novel.
